[bundlerepository/utils] NOTICE issues

Hi,

The NOTICE files of both the bundlerepository and the utils project
mention, that OSGi provided software is contained.

AFAICT for utils this has never been the case and for bundlerepository
this is not the case since the OBR API has been broken out into a
separate bundle.

So, can we remove the clause:

  This product includes software developed at
  The OSGi Alliance (http://www.osgi.org/).
  Copyright (c) OSGi Alliance (2000, 2007).
  Licensed under the Apache License 2.0.

from the NOTICE files in the bundlrepository and utils project ?

At the same time we might want to set OSGi Copyright year of the OSGi
software use to 2009, right ?
